Subject: Heads up — thumbnail queue key rotated

Hi folks,

Quick note for the review: we rotated the key the Snapframe thumbnail workers use to pull jobs from the Gridline queue. Old key is revoked as of this morning, logs confirm no stragglers. For completeness, the new key for the queue service is below.

API key for yahig-tadup: kto7_ubizbYm

14:22 — metrics-aggregation sidecar (Grelth) OOM-killed on three nodes. 14:25 — dashboards flatlined; paging fired. 14:31 — identified unbounded label cardinality from the new tenant tagger. 14:38 — rolled sidecar back, capped label sets. 14:50 — aggregation recovered; no data loss, five-minute gap backfilled from raw stream. Follow-up: cardinality limiter ships next sprint. Rollback artifact is recorded below.

trace token, bagag-fahag: htk21_1a5003b533f7b0cca4331

## Env Vars: Locker Access Flow

The Tumblecrate locker service uses LOCKER_OPEN_TIMEOUT and LOCKER_RETRY_MAX to govern the door-release flow. Both must be set before the gateway boots, or pickups stall at the QR step. The gateway also signs unlock requests with a shared secret, defined on the line directly below.

vault entry, yahif-yajep: COURIER_KEY29=b802bdf8034096b65a51c6ba5abe2

Adds offline playback to the Hallward Museum audio-guide app. Tracks now prefetch when a visitor enters a gallery beacon zone instead of streaming on demand. Cuts buffering complaints and handles the basement galleries with no signal. Cache eviction is LRU per gallery; storage cap is enforced at download time. Tested on the Vexley device fleet only — verify older hardware before broadening rollout. Prefetch and cache behavior is controlled by the constants below.

constants for fajop-tahaf:
RATE_LIMITS = {
    "holael": 2,
    "oliael": 10,
    "druael": 10,
    "wenwyn": 10,
}